Insides are often a mess as everyone thinks the parking brakes are fit and forget. They need to be cleaned and services annually if you do lots of miles.

The 'mess' is if the parking brake cables are seized or broken at the mounting point on the rear shock lower bracket. With the rear brakes in bits, have someone pull slowly on the parking brake lever and see if the cables move smoothly, then have them release the lever and pull a little on the end of the cable at the wheel and see if they move back. If not, then you have to drop to the rear jacking points and front stay bar brackets to replace the parking brake cables. Hours of endless fun!!
